"sharing knowledge" is a perfectly valid phrase in written English
You can use it to refer to a variety of scenarios, such as transferring information to another person, or mutual exchange of ideas. For example: "At our company, we value the sharing of knowledge and encourage employees to openly share ideas with one another."
